serialized US
ˈsɪrɪəˌlaɪzd
See also: serialised (UK)
Definition

Definition of serialized - Reverso English Dictionary

Adjective

1.
televisionUSpresented in a sequence of connected partsUS
  • The show was serialized for weekly viewing.
episodic sequential
2.
orderUSarranged in a sequenceUS
  • The episodes were serialized for weekly release.
arranged ordered sequenced
3.
technologyTECH.USconverted into a sequence for storageTECH.US
  • The data was serialized for transmission.
arranged ordered sequenced
4.
literatureUSpublished in parts over timeUS
  • The novel was serialized in the magazine.

serialize US
ˈsɪəriəlaɪz
See also: serialise (UK)

Definition of serialize - Reverso English Dictionary

Verb

tr.
1.
organizationRareUSarrange or perform in a sequenceRareUS
  • The computer program was designed to serialize the data processing tasks..
order sequence
2.
technologyTECH.USconvert data into a sequence of bytesTECH.US
  • The program can serialize the data for storage.
marshal stream
3.
publishingRareUSwrite a story in parts for publicationRareUS
  • The author decided to serialize her novel in the magazine.
